maspeak
Log in
Sign up
maspeak
Sign up
Log in
I'm learning
italiano
doccia — Italian to English translation
doccia means
shower
in English. Learn vocabulary with Maspeak.
Guess the translation for
shower
doccia
attrice
actress
burro
butter
pesca
fishing
chimica
chemistry
Skip this question
Example sentences
Learn italian with Maspeak →
Italian 500